Skip to main content

Log4j

Less than 1 minuteJavaLog4jjavajdkkotlinlog4jlog4j2

Log4j 관련


예제: log4j2.properties

예제

@tab:active 기본

status=warn
name=DemoLog

appenders = stdout

# 콘솔 출력 설정
appender.stdout.type                     = Console
appender.stdout.name                     = STDOUT
appender.stdout.layout.type              = PatternLayout
appender.stdout.layout.pattern           = [%t] %-5p : %c.%M(%F:%L) %-80m %n
appender.stdout.filter.threshold.type    = ThresholdFilter
appender.stdout.filter.threshold.level   = debug

rootLogger.level                         = debug
rootLogger.appenderRef.stdout.additivity = false
rootLogger.appenderRef.stdout.ref        = STDOUT

Layout Pattern(s)

  • %d{yyyy-MM-dd HH:mm:ss} %-5p : $c.%M(%F:$L) %-80m %n
  • [%t] %-5p : %c.%M(%F:%L) %-80m %n
  • %-5p | %d{yyyy-MM-dd HH:mm:ss} | [%t] %C{2} (%F:%L) - %m%n
  • %d{yyyy-MM-dd HH:mm:ss} %-5p %c{1}:%L - %m%n

이찬희 (MarkiiimarK)
Never Stop Learning.